May 9, 2009 — -- Everyone gets them in the mail, but most don't bother to open them up. Those furniture catalogs with big-ticket items aren't in most family's budgets, but do fancy furnishings always have to come with premium pricetags?
D-I-Y expert and professional artisan Michele Beschen doesn't think so.
"Furniture catalogs are great," says Beschen. "You can look at the page and decide. Can I build this? Where can I get this? Are there some materials in the room that I maybe already have around the house? It's one-stop design."
"GMA" Weekend challenged one family to pick a room from a furniture catalog and recreate it on a budget, and with Beschen's expert advice.
Alex and Krystal Hatfield from Urbandale, Iowa, are closer than most teenage sisters: they share a room and a tiny double sized bed.
The sisters scoured expensive furniture catalogs and picked their dream bedroom. Using supplies from around their house, a garage sale, and a home improvement store, Beschen taught the family how to makeover their room, D-I-Y style.
The Hatfields were able to recreate the catalog's expensive room for only 1/7 the cost. That's like buying the whole room at an 85 percent clearance sale!
